Stellar Flares and Coronal Structure

M. Guedel

astro-pharXiv:astro-ph/0312378

Abstract

Coronal structure and coronal heating are intimately related in magnetically active stars. Coronal structure is commonly inferred from radio interferometry and from eclipse and rotational modulation studies. We discuss to what extent flares may be responsible for coronal structure and global observable properties in magnetically active stars.
